Souvenir Hunting


Sweeney's at nearby Achill Sound has a wide range
of presents for the folks back home. There are
plenty of books on sale including the mummy porn
best-seller "Fifty Shades of Grey", which is
extremely popular in Ireland right now. For those
of a more sombre nature, there are also graveside
memorials such as this colourful tableau with
stigmata saint Padre Pio. Even the animals have
their own tributes including "Beloved Cat. You've
made our home special".
